        <description>[Clang] Enable __has_feature(coverage_sanitizer)Like other sanitizers, enable __has_feature(coverage_sanitizer) if clanghas enabled at least one SanitizerCoverage instrumentation type.Because coverage instrumentation selection is not handled via normal-fsanitize= (and thus not in SanitizeSet), passing this informationthrough to LangOptions required propagating the already parsed-fsanitize-coverage= options from CodeGenOptions through to LangOptionsin FixupInvocation().Reviewed By: aaron.ballmanDifferential Revision: https://reviews.llvm.org/D103159
